Big news in the HBCU football world — the highly anticipated FAMU vs. Mississippi Valley State game at Mercedes-Benz Stadium has been officially postponed and rescheduled for November 29th. In this week’s HBCU Gameday Podcast, Tolly Carr, Vaughn Wilson, and Wilton Jackson break down what went wrong with the event’s planning and how fans, players, and promoters are reacting.
We also dive into:
The fallout from Joe Bullard’s comments about Alabama State’s Honeybees and the cultural conversation it sparked.
Fort Valley State’s band suspension and its impact on homecoming.
A controversial ejection that may have cost Delaware State a key win.
Who’s emerging as the front-runners in the SWAC East & West as we march toward the Celebration Bowl.
Michael Vick’s first-year coaching challenges at Norfolk State.
